  In Ubuntu 12.10, when I close the laptop lid, the wlan connection is
  closed. Wired (ethernet) connections keep working normally.
  
  This prevents using only external monitor in places where wired
  connections are not accessible and forces the user to keep the laptop
  display on even if it is not needed.
  
  Changing the power manager settings to "Do nothing" does not affect
  this. It also does not matter if the laptop is plugged in or not.
  
  Looking at this discussion, it seems this problem has existed at least
  from Ubuntu 8.04, and Kubuntu is affected as well:
